Which AMD Chipsets Are Compatible with Mini ITX Motherboards?

Popular AMD chipsets for Mini ITX include X570 (PCIe 4.0 support), B550 (balanced features), and A520 (budget-friendly). These support Ryzen 5000/7000 CPUs, with X670E models now emerging for AM5 sockets and DDR5 memory compatibility.

Chipset CPU Support PCIe Version Overclocking
X570 Ryzen 3000/5000 4.0 Yes
B550 Ryzen 3000/5000 3.0/4.0 Limited
X670E Ryzen 7000 5.0 Yes

How Does Cooling Affect Mini ITX Build Performance?

Effective cooling is critical due to confined spaces. Low-profile air coolers like Noctua NH-L9a or 240mm AIO liquid coolers maintain Ryzen thermal headroom. Strategic case fan placement and thermal pad upgrades on VRM heatsinks prevent throttling in compact builds.

Modern Mini ITX cases like the Cooler Master NR200P Max demonstrate optimized thermal design, supporting 280mm radiators while maintaining a 18L footprint. Users should prioritize airflow-oriented cases with mesh panels over glass-heavy designs – thermal testing shows up to 12°C differences under load. For CPU cooling, the Thermalright AXP90-X47 outperforms similar-height coolers with its copper base and six heat pipes, capable of handling 105W TDP processors at 47mm height. Pairing with high-static pressure fans like Noctua NF-A12x25 ensures efficient heat dissipation even in restricted spaces.

How to Optimize Storage in AMD Mini ITX Systems?

Utilize both front and back M.2 slots (PCIe 4.0 x4) for NVMe storage. Some cases support 2-4 SATA SSDs via clever mounting. The ASUS ROG Strix X570-I uniquely offers a PCIe 4.0 M.2 expansion card for additional high-speed storage.

Advanced users can implement RAID 0 configurations across dual M.2 slots for sequential read speeds exceeding 10,000 MB/s. The Fractal Design Ridge case demonstrates smart storage integration with dedicated 2.5″ drive bays behind the motherboard tray. For content creators, combining a 4TB PCIe 4.0 NVMe boot drive with secondary QLC-based storage balances speed and capacity. Recent boards like the Gigabyte B650I AORUS Ultra feature PCIe 5.0 M.2 slots capable of 14,000 MB/s sequential reads, though adequate heatsinking becomes mandatory to prevent thermal throttling during sustained transfers.

FAQ

Q: Can ITX boards handle RTX 4090 GPUs?
A: Yes, using PCIe 4.0 x16 slots. However, ensure case compatibility with 3-4 slot GPUs and adequate power supply (850W+ recommended).
Q: Do Mini ITX boards support ECC memory?
A: Select ASRock Rack and ASUS Pro models offer ECC support, particularly with Ryzen Pro CPUs.
Q: What’s the lifespan of Mini ITX motherboards?
A: Quality boards typically last 5-7 years. AM5 socket models future-proofed for next-gen Ryzen CPUs through 2025+.
